Kim Fields cannot handle another season of the bullshit that comes with being on Real Housewives of Atlanta. So after just one season, she’s leaving (leaving) on a midnight train to Georgia. She says she’s going back (going back to find) a simpler place and time.
Fields confirmed the news in an interview with The Rickey Smiley Morning Show in Atlanta. When the host asks if she can tolerate a second season of RHOA, given how ill-fit for the experience she seemed throughout it, Fields says, “Feels more like Brett Favre and the Jets, you know. I’m done. Think about, at the beginning of the season, what did my mama say? ‘Get in and Get out.’ Listen to your mama.”
It’s for the best. Fields claims she had fun taping, but it really didn’t show much except when she was around Phaedra. “It was for the experience,” says Fields. “It was to be able to do a genre that I’d been asked to do before and finding a way to do it that makes sense for my team and I and the family. Overall, it was a really great experience.”
This fast exit is absolutely no surprise, since Kim was clearly out of her element and over it from the start, so much so that her position as an outsider became a topic of shade and led to a vacation breakdown. In Sunday’s reunion episode, Andy Cohen asked everyone if they felt Kim was out of her element on the show and most agreed. They all think she’s either too non-confrontational or too judgmental. And so, Kim was given the highest compliment ever: being told that you’re not reality TV material.
Shame, because Kim was just getting a feel for the drama, with most of her friction coming from Kenya Moore, who accused Kim of “belittling” her and the other cast members while taping. Here’s video of Kim screaming “You don’t get to keep interrupting people!” at Kenya during the reunion, and then daring her to “say something.” It’s probably the second best RHOA reunion moment after Phaedra’s “Fix it Jesus.” Mama was proud.
However, Kim has already moved on to bigger and better things, being a contestant on Dancing With the Stars. May she find peace.
